Fix docker CI

Signed-off-by: Kakadu <Kakadu@pm.me>
This commit is contained in:
Kakadu 2025-02-28 22:23:56 +03:00
parent aead6095c7
commit 92cc13f1fd

View file

@ -6,6 +6,7 @@ on:
- 'i686-cross' - 'i686-cross'
env: env:
OPAMROOT: /home/user/.opam
OPAMCONFIRMLEVEL: unsafe-yes OPAMCONFIRMLEVEL: unsafe-yes
jobs: jobs:
@ -13,18 +14,16 @@ jobs:
runs-on: ubuntu-24.04 runs-on: ubuntu-24.04
container: container:
image: kakadu18/ocaml:lama image: kakadu18/ocaml:lama
#options: --user user
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
steps: steps:
- run: opam --version - run: opam --version
- run: opam init --disable-sandboxing -y - run: whoami
- run: opam exec -- ocamlopt --version - run: opam exec -- ocamlopt --version
- name: Cancel Previous Runs
uses: styfle/cancel-workflow-action@0.11.0
with:
access_token: ${{ github.token }}
- name: Checkout code - name: Checkout code
uses: actions/checkout@v4 uses: actions/checkout@v4
@ -32,7 +31,6 @@ jobs:
opam install . --depext-only --with-test --with-doc opam install . --depext-only --with-test --with-doc
opam install . --deps-only --with-test --with-doc opam install . --deps-only --with-test --with-doc
- name: List installed packages - name: List installed packages
run: opam list run: opam list